Structure, Governance and Management

The Church registered as a Charitable Incorporated Organisation and its objects are to promote the Christian faith. For the furtherance of this aim regular activities are carried out and invitations given out to the public.

Appointment of the trustees is governed by the Constitution of the Charity. The current board of trustees constitutes three members. Details of the trustees who have served during the period are given on page 3. The Finance is raised from the congregation's contributions and Gift Aid.

The board of trustees is authorised to appoint new trustees to fill vacancies through resignation or death of an existing trustee until the following AGM, whereupon congregational members will be invited to confirm the new trustee by vote. Other than the Church’s pastor, trustees are appointed to two-year terms, and may serve for a maximum of six consecutive years. The trustees retain the collective responsibility for major financial decisions and investments and board meetings are held monthly.
